Ame G.

Good, clean, relaxed, and friendly boba tea lounge. No prices on any of their menu boards (a personal pet peeve of mine regarding business transparency). From what I gathered, only one size (large) drink is offered and begins at $7.00. Adding toppings is an additional $0.75. While this is the highest priced boba tea drink I've purchased in quite a while, it is worth it. Lots of flavor combinations to enjoy, good tea quality, and the option to customize is always appreciated. Staff was friendly and helpful (thanks Heidi!). Nice lounge atmosphere that's open and spacious, with good seating for groups. A cozy corner with card and board games is also provided. Plenty of parking and a dog friendly patio outside. Our favorite drinks so far have been: the Hokkaido, Rose Garden, and Taro Blurry. Definitely recommend any of those, and look forward to returning to try more from their menu. There's a true Italian culture happening here…read more They serve Lavazza and build their menu around classic Italian cafe traditions. Think cappuccinos made the proper way, rich espresso drinks, and smooth lattes finished with beautiful art. They also make the best honey latte in the city, crafted with local raw, unfiltered desert honey. The best! The cafe offers both bright, cozy indoor seating and outdoor options under umbrellas. The worn-in leather chairs feel like they're waiting just for you, and it's the kind of place that convinces me to slow down, savor my drink, and linger longer than I planned. Beyond coffee, they serve breakfast and lunch plates, plus sweet and savory pastries. The avocado toast with ricotta, strawberries, pumpkin seeds, and honey has incredible flavor and texture. Fun fact: owned by a few poker players, the most notable being Todd Brunson, son of Hall of Famer Doyle Brunson.
